Creating a Related/Suggested Products Block

The way to accomplish this is you will need to set up a different query to populate your left column. but first you will need to add a column to your products table (recommendedProductID or something like that) which will have the id of that product. The query will do a look up using the cart id as the filter. So the printer will have a recommnededProductID of the ink type for that printer. And then you could just apply an add to cart server behavior to the left column using that record set.

there is a few other cases that i'm not sure if you want to handle, like if you added two different kind of printers, but i think this should get you going in the right direction.
